What are the most important historical places and other sights in Ferrara?
Ferrara is notable for its a cathedral and landmarks like Castle Estense, Teatro Comunale and Ferrara Cathedral. Cultural venues include Palazzo dei Diamanti, Palazzo Massari and Palazzo Schifanoia.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are Botanical Garden and Herbarium and Piazza Ariostea.
What is a historic hotel like in Ferrara?
When you choose a historic hotel, you'll enjoy a holiday someplace that has a national historic designation. A castle, a palace or even a pub or an old police station can be transformed into a historic hotel provided that it has special significance. Traditional architecture and period features are typically preserved in the public spaces and guestrooms of these historic hotels in Ferrara, giving a real sense of character.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
You'll often hear the term "heritage hotel" in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is a term often used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of historic hotels tend to be the most significant aspect. For a heritage hotel, it's mainly the cultural value and how it shaped the community.
